Of all the upcoming 2025 nail trends, there’s one that immediately spoke to my inner magpie—the shift towards subtle, sparkly nails. I’m going to be honest, I’ve always loved a glittery manicure. In fact, I remember painting my nails in a pink, glitzy Barry M number for the first day of a new job in my early 20s only to quickly realise that not everyone felt the same about a sparkly mani. And when one colleague snobbishly mentioned that my nails looked like a Christmas tree (it was October) I painstakingly removed them at home that evening and never wore glittery nails to work again outside of the festive season.

This year however? Glitter has got a whole lot more grown-up, and I’d hazard a bet that even that ex-colleague of mine might be tempted to embrace a sparkly manicure with so many brilliant shimmer polishes entering the market. Rather than a dramatic disco ball effect, however, this year’s iteration of glitter nails comes in the form of microscopic sparkle and subtle shimmer. Heck, even Dior has launched a limited edition top coat in an opalescent blue shimmer shade—proving that glitter can be grown-up and chic.
